Do-it-Yourself and Save
Potential Savings on average by Percentage
Contractor mark up (30%) Project manager mark up (6%)Clean up, demolition painting/misc. (5%)_________________________________ ***Total potential savings 41%
On average 60% of the amount spent on remodeling will be recouped upon resale of your home
*** Based on national averages not an official quote for services.
Potential Savings ExamplesIn the bathroom you could save like this:• Bathroom remodeling encompasses many
facets: cabinets, tile, flooring, decor, countertops, plumbing, painting etc.
• National average for bathroom remodel is $16,000
• Contractor mark up (30%) = $4,800 • Project manager mark up (6%) = $960 • Clean up, demolition, painting/misc. (5%) =
$800 • Total potential savings 41% = $6,500
In the kitchen you could save like this:• Kitchen remodeling encompasses many
facets: appliances, cabinets, flooring, decor, countertops, etc.
• National average for kitchen remodel is $45,000
• Contractor mark up (30%) = $13,500 • Project manager mark up (6%) = $2,700 • Clean up, demolition, painting/misc. (5%) =
$2,250 • Total potential savings 41% = $18,450
